titleOfInvention | Styrenic expandable resin particles, expanded beads and molded products |
abstract | P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To provide a styrene foam resin particle, a styrene foam bead, and a foam molded product having low VOC (low volatile organic compound) performance and a high use limit multiple. [Solution] In the suspension polymerization of styrene monomer, in the late stage of polymerization, the styrene monomer is added while keeping the oxygen concentration in the reaction vessel low at 7% by volume or less and adsorbed on the styrene resin particles in the middle of the polymerization. A method for producing a styrene-based expandable resin particle in which a polymerization reaction is advanced and pentane is impregnated as a foaming agent. The particles obtained by this method have a selectively high outer molecular weight. By impregnating pentane as a foaming agent, low VOC (low volatile organic compound) performance is possible, and the outer molecular weight is high, so the appearance and strength of the foamed particles are excellent.
